Highlights
Are people in Sandusky older or younger than people in St. Charles?
- The Median Age in Sandusky is 4.4 years older than in St. Charles.

Are housing costs cheaper in Sandusky or St. Charles?
- Sandusky housing costs are 28.2% more expensive than St. Charles hous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Sandusky or St. Charles?
- The average commute for residents of Sandusky is 3.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of St. Charles.
